Usher in the Christmas Spirit with CC&FC

| @indiablooms | Dec 24, 2019, at 01:10 pm

Calcutta Cricket & Football Club, one of the oldest clubs in Asia, is all set to usher in the Christmas spirit with an amazing event.

CCFC asks Kolkata to be a part of the most rocking Christmas Eve party with the live performance of ‘Rock this Country’, a popular dance band from Sri Lanka!
